WebSep 26, 2024 · In practice, memos don't include a signature. However, sometimes managers are wise to include their initials next to their name in the header. The real trick is knowing … WebA deductive style of writing a memo presents ideas in decreasing order of importance and assumes the reader is acquainted with the topic. Most memos use this pattern. To write in a deductive manner, place supporting facts in subsequent sentences for readers who are unfamiliar with the subject. Background information should be presented last.
